Peter Toft wrote:
> Often I use "cvs -n update -r TAG" to see which files will be updated
> when I update from the current version of my files to the release tag "TAG".
> What I do need also are the version numbers of the files.
[...]
> Any clues on how to get near my wish?
'cvs di -r TAG --brief' will give the revisions used:
$ cvs di -rHEAD --brief
Index: test.txt
===================================================================
RCS file: /cvs/cvs-test/test.txt,v
retrieving revision 1.12
retrieving revision 1.11
diff -u --brief -r1.12 -r1.11
Files /tmp/cvsOhGtSK and /tmp/cvsrSlA6W differ
You may want to write a script to make the output more concise.
Note that TAG should be a branch tag or HEAD in order for this to work
properly.
